Single Serving Blueberry Crumble Prep Time: 5 minutes Cook Time: 20 minutes Total Time: 25 minutes Yield: 1 serving Ingredients 2/3 cups / 160 ml blueberries, fresh or frozen 1 tbsp maple syrup 1/2 tsp vanilla extract Crumble topping: 1/4 cup / 24 g almond flour 1/4 cup / 22 g rolled oats 2 tsp maple syrup 1 tbsp coconut oil Instructions

A crisp has a streusel topping instead of cake or biscuit. It's made from butter and oats. A crumble also has a crumbly topping, but instead of using oats, it uses flour, sugar, and butter.

Preheat oven to 350°F. In an 8 ounce ramekin, mix the blueberries with 1 teaspoon lemon juice, 2 tablespoons sugar, and 1 1/2 teaspoons cornstarch. In a small bowl, mix the 3 tablespoons brown sugar, 2 tablespoons rolled oats, 3 tablespoons all purpose flour, 1/8 teaspoon cinnamon, and pinch of salt.

Preheat the oven to 400°F. In a medium sized bowl, cut the butter into the flour with two knives until the pieces of butter are quite small. Finish off mixing the butter into the flour with the tips of your fingers, until it resembles a "crumble" mixture. Stir in the sugar. Set aside.
